This feature highlights the idiom 「其樂不窮」, with its meaning and examples shown below.

Poor: to the end, to the end. Refers to the endless fun that something brings. Also written as “the joy is endless” and “the joy is boundless”.

The Mandarin pronunciation of this idiom is :

qí lè bù qióng

while its Cantonese pinyin is :

kei4 lok6/ngok6 bat1 kung4
